How much does a super fluke weigh when you fish it weightless? I know senkos are really heavy like 3/8 but haven't seen any thing about a super fluke.

Posted

Don't have one on me to weigh as they are all out in the boat but I'd say right around the same as a 5" senko, maybe a TAD less than a true GYB senko. Probably in the 5/16 range.
